Historical Morrow House Season 5 Fixer Upper, Featured In Cottage Style Magazine

  • Our historical home was on the first episode of season 5 of Fixer Upper. When Mrs. Gaines toured the house as the second option they called it #TheRealFixerUpper! It was not a home ultimately designed by the Gaines's but we are honored to be a small part of the filming. The excitement for the home was captured best when Joanna Gaines said "I feel like a dog with a T-bone steak, I am like please give ME the T-bone steak!"
    Since its renovation in 2017 The Morrow House has been featured in Cottage Style Magazine, Modern Farmhouse Style Magazine and Modern Texas Living Magazine. The Morrow House is also featured in the new book titled "Historic Homes of Waco Texas".

    The Morrow House is a 130 year old home restored by Crown Construction in 2017. They and designer Amy Normand took elaborate care to restore the huge pocket doors, original trim around the home and refinish by hand all 33 windows to bring it back to its original stately presence. It is a beautiful piece of Waco history and there was no expense was spared in the detail, design or furnishings in this charming three bedroom three bathroom home! From the large chandeliers to the tiniest of trim work, this home is one of the most beautiful homes in Waco!

    The home is owned by Kimberlee Rodriguez and her family. They are thrilled to share this Central Texas treasure with visitors while they explore the wonders of Waco. The home has a beautiful living space, fully equipped kitchen, and a large dining area for everyone to gather for dinner, games and great conversation. Our beds are luxurious and each bedroom has a private bath.

    The Morrow House is close to great shopping, delicious places to eat and Baylor University!
